55问答网
所有问题
当前搜索:
oracle刷新user_tables表
oracle
中
user_tables表
各字段意思是什么?
答:
user
_stats-是否有统计duration-临时表的时间skip_corrupt-是否忽略损坏的块标记在表和索引扫描(ENABLED)状态的或将引发一个错误(已禁用)。 monitoring-是否有监测属性集cluster_owner-群集的所有者dependencies-行依赖性跟踪是否已启用compression-是否启用表压缩compress_for-什么样的操作的默认压缩dropped-...
oracle的user_tables表
中没有新增的表怎么回事
答:
奇怪的问题往往是误操作所致,首先确认你用的用户,和你查看的表是不是在当前用户下,然后看有没有这个名字的同义词 为什么我在
oracle
中 sele...CSDN编程社区
oracle
中怎么在一个用户(B)中查询另一个用户(A)的use_
tables表
?
答:
由于
user_tables表
的特殊性,基于权限的方法目前尚未找到合适方法,不过你可以通过创建视图进行解决 一.第一种方法,在dba 用户下创建基于dba_tables的视图;1.create view V_A_tables as select * from dba_tables where owner='A';2.grant select on V_A_tables to B;3. 进入用户B, sele...
oracle
dba_
tables表
怎么才能让其每天更新,last_anaylzed 字段在什么...
答:
1 在安装
Oracle的
时候,就默认创建了一个名为GATHER_STATS_JOB的job来自动收集优化器统计信息。这个job收集数据库中所有对象的统计信息。默认的情况下这个job是周一到周五每天晚上10点到第二天早上6点以及整个周末来收集统计信息。2 手动收集统计信息。
oracle
中“
user_tab
_partitions”这个表的作用是什么?
答:
user_part_
tables
:记录分区的表的信息;
user_tab
_partitions:记录表的分区的信息。 2)
ORACLE
函数介绍(详细需要自己搜索) 注:N表示数字型,C表示字符型,D表示日期型,[]表示内中参数可被忽略,fmt表示格式。 分析函数计算基于group by的列,分组查询出的行被称为"比照(window)",在根据over()执行过程中,针对每一行...
oracle
查看所有表及各表行数
答:
rows两个字段即可。table_name是表名,num_rows代表表的行数。具体如下:1、查询数据库所有的表sql:select t.table_name,t.num_rows from all_tables t;sql执行后的输出结果如下图:2、查询当前用户表sql:select t.table_name,t.num_rows from
user_tables
t;sql执行后输出结果如下图:...
oracle
中怎么用sql查表以及表的字段名
答:
1、用sql查表 查表的时候需要用到
user_tables
、all_tables,user_tables查出来的是该用户拥有的表,all_tables查出来的是所有用户的表。2、用sql查表的字段 查表的字段需要用到user_tab_columns、all_tab_columns,一样的前者只能查到该用户拥有的表,后者可以查询所有用户的表。3、其他 与上面类似...
如何快捷地查询
Oracle
中每个用户表的表名和行数?
答:
user_tables
数据字典中也有表的行数 NUM_ROWS 字段,但除非你对该用户进行统计信息收集(运行 dbms_stat.gather_schema_stats()系统包)否则该字段要么没有值,要么值是过期的数据,不准确. 正确的做法是:对数据库用户进行统计信息收集后,立刻执行:select table_name,num_rows from user_tables;...
Oracle
某个表有记录,为什么
user_tables
中num_rows为空
答:
首先你使用1、select t.table_name,t.num_rows from user_tables t;查询不到结果时,可以手动执行分析
user_tables表
,过程如下:1)create or replace function count_rows(table_name in varchar2,owner in varchar2 default null)return number authid current_user IS num_rows number;stmt varc...
如何查看
oracle数据库
中的所有表
答:
查看
oracle
中的所有表可通过查询
user_tables
这个系统表来获得。语句如下:select * from user_tables;查询结果中红框就是所有的表。
1
2
3
4
5
6
7
8
9
10
涓嬩竴椤
灏鹃〉
其他人还搜
oracle刷新user_dependencies表
oracle更新num_rows
oracle数据库查看字段类型
oracle刷新执行计划
oracle查看数据库命令
Oracle查看profile
oracle物化视图定时刷新
oracle重命名
Oracle最大连接数